-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Fedora Update Notification FEDORA-2024-dcc531165e 2024-05-11 01:36:38.084635 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Name : python-damo Product : Fedora 38 Version : 2.3.3 Release : 1.fc38 URL : https://github.com/awslabs/damo Summary : Data Access Monitoring Operator Description : damo is a user space tool for DAMON. Using this, you can monitor the data access patterns of your system or workloads and make data access-aware memory management optimizations.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Update Information: Latest 2.3.3 release; see https://github.com/awslabs/damo/blob/next/release_note for full release notes Changes since 2.2.8: v2.3.3 Support memory footprint recording for non-process and ongoing targets damo report wss: Do --collapse_targets by default damo record: Do --include_child_tasks by default v2.3.2 Support system memory footprints recording/reporting v2.3.1 Hotfix release for bugs that intorudced with v2.3.0 v2.3.0 Implement 'damo report footprints' v2.2.9 Cleanup code -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- ChangeLog: * Thu May 2 2024 Michel Lind <salimma@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x> - 2.3.3-1 - Update to 2.3.3 - Resolves: rhbz#2277883 * Mon Apr 22 2024 Packit <hello@xxxxxxxxxx> - 2.3.2-1 - Update to 2.3.2 - Resolves rhbz#2276515 * Mon Apr 15 2024 Packit <hello@xxxxxxxxxx> - 2.3.1-1 - Update to 2.3.1 - Resolves rhbz#2274065 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- References: [ 1 ] Bug #2277883 - python-damo-2.3.3 is available https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2277883 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- This update can be installed with the "dnf" update program.
